The Purrington Post explains that these cats have a predominance of a certain pigment known as pheomelanin-the same pigment that produces red hair in humans.ĥ. You’ve probably noticed a variation in felines’ ginger-colored hues, from reddish-orange to yellowish-cream. They have four different patterns - and none of them is solid orange All orange cats are tabbies, but not all tabbies are orange.ģ. Tabby cats are striped due to the agouti gene. The word itself is taken from a striped silk fabric made near Baghdad. Many people, even cat lovers, don’t know that “tabby” refers to specific coat markings, not a breed (and regardless of color). Because females possess two Xs and males possess XY, male cats only need the orange gene from their mothers to become a ginger - making them much more likely to carry on the trait. Scientists and researchers are fairly certain that orange tabbies’ color transpires from a sex-linked gene, with the X chromosome responsible for the orange coloring.
